美文网首页
nohup 后台不挂断运行程序

nohup 后台不挂断运行程序

作者: 学EE的AlvinLO | 来源:发表于2020-06-28 21:34 被阅读0次

nohup的意思是忽略SIGHUP信号, 所以当运行nohup python test.py的时候, 关闭shell, 那么这个python进程还是存在的(对SIGHUP信号免疫)。 但是, 要注意, 如果你直接在shell中用Ctrl C, 那么, 这个python进程也是会消失的(因为对SIGINT信号不免疫)

注意并没有后台运行的功能,就是指,用nohup运行命令可以使命令永久的执行下去,和用户终端没有关系,例如我们断开SSH连接都不会影响他的运行,注意了nohup没有后台运行的意思;&才是后台运行

***如果想让进程在后台不挂断的运行,需要nohup和&结合起来使用

nohup nohup python test.py &> /var/log/python.log &

https://www.cnblogs.com/mingyue5826/p/11572228.html

相关文章

  • linux——nohup后台运行,ps查看等命令

    nohup和&搭配,后台运行命令 不挂断的运行命令:nohup Command [ Arg … ] [&]nohu...

  • 转录组分析 1下载文件

    常识 1、关于命令的后台运行 & : 指在后台运行。nohup : 不挂断的运行。就是指,用nohup运行命令可以...

  • 深入理解nohup和&

    nohup和&后台运行,进程查看及终止 1.nohup 用途:不挂断地运行命令。语法:nohup Command ...

  • 守护进程 Linux nohup 命令

    nohup 英文全称 no hang up(不挂起),用于在系统后台不挂断地运行命令,退出终端不会影响程序的运行。...

  • nohup不输出nohup.out日志信息

    nohup 英文全称 no hang up(不挂起),用于在系统后台不挂断地运行命令,退出终端不会影响程序的运行。...

  • nohup 后台不挂断运行程序

    nohup的意思是忽略SIGHUP信号, 所以当运行nohup python test.py的时候, 关闭shel...

  • nohup和&使用

    转自 nohup和&后台运行,进程查看及终止 1.nohup 用途:不挂断地运行命令。 语法:nohup Comm...

  • 后台不挂载运行

    命令:nohup 运行程序命令 & nohup : 不挂载运行 & : 后台运行

  • 记录常用linux指令(持续更新)

    nohup 持续不挂断的后台运行nohup java -jar demo.jar >./log.txt 2>&1 ...

  • 命令

    nohup nohup 不挂断运行命令>out.txt 将输出重定向到 out.txt& 在后台运行jobs 显示...

网友评论

      本文标题:nohup 后台不挂断运行程序

      本文链接:https://www.haomeiwen.com/subject/ngnifktx.html